Delays, Delays, Delays for Online Gambling in Pennsylvania

Lawmakers in Pennsylvania have delayed a vote on a bill that could eventually lead to the legalisation of online gaming in the US state. As reported by iGaming Business, a Pennsylvania House Committee was due to meet yesterday to discuss a bill put forward by State Representative John Payne. Bill HB649 pushes for the legalisation of online gambling to existing licence holders in the state – similar to the current regulatory framework in New Jersey. However, the House Committee opted to delay a vote on the bill due to ongoing budget negotiations.

Possible Merger Delays Ladbrokes Business Presentation

Ladbrokes has opted to delay a planned business review presentation due to the ongoing talks over a possible merger with rival operator Gala Coral. As reported by iGaming Business, both parties confirmed last week that they had begun discussions over the possibility of merging to form a larger operation. The proposed deal would involve Ladbrokes and Gala Coral-operated Coral Retail, Eurobet Retail and the company’s online business. Ladbrokes was due to make a business review presentation of its own tomorrow (Tuesday), but has now opted to defer this until further notice.
